struts 第一步

记录一下
1 Eclipse 开发web应用 创建一个web项目


2 Struts 2.3.20 使用到的包 

commons-fileupload-1.3.1.jar  

commons-io-2.2.jar

commons-lang3-3.2.jar

commons-logging-1.1.3.jar

freemarker-2.3.19.jar

javassist-3.7.ga.jar

ognl-3.0.6.jar

struts2-core-2.3.20.jar

xwork-core-2.3.20.jar

如果没自带JSP的话还需要包

servlet-api.jar

jsp-api.jar

3 web.xml 文件内容

<filter>

<filter-name>struts2</filter-name>

<filter-class>org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ecuteFilter

</filter-class>

</filter>

<filter-mapping>

<filter-name>struts2</filter-name>

<url-pattern>/*</url-pattern>

</filter-mapping>

4 struts.xml 文件内容

<include file="struts-default.xml"></include>

    <package name="a" extends="struts-default">

       <action name="Text" class="com.agents.text.Text">

           <result name="ok">/thefirst.jsp</result>

       </action>

    </package>

5 类 

public class Text extends ActionSupport

6jsp 

thefirst.jsp

7发布 浏览器填写 http://localhost:8080/xxxx/Text.action

猜你喜欢

转载自jimheaven.iteye.com/blog/2197673